Lane Kiffin, head coach of Ole Miss, finds himself in a unique situation as his team prepares to face LSU. The matchup is intensified by the personal connection between Kiffin's daughter, Landry, and LSU linebacker Whit Weeks, who are dating. This relationship has added a layer of drama to the SEC rivalry, with Kiffin responding humorously to the situation on social media. Despite the personal ties, Kiffin maintains that the relationship does not affect the game itself, focusing on the upcoming high-scoring affair between the two teams.
